电梯轿厢意外移动检测探析
韦昌材
(广西壮族自治区特种设备检验研究院河池分院,广西 河池 547000)

摘  要:随着高层住宅及商务楼的增多,电梯对于人们生活的便利越来越重要,它的安全性也日渐受到人们的重视。电梯轿厢的移动很容易发生挤压、剪切等意外事故,严重影响财产及生命安全,所以对电梯轿厢运行过程中的监测,可以准确获知电梯轿厢的意外移动,并及时采取措施,以免造成事故损失。因此,为了解决电梯轿厢意外移动的安全隐患,对其进行检测和保护装置的安装及设计很重要,需要能准确读取电梯轿厢运行过程中的状态,避免可能存留的风险,预防事故的发生。


关键词:电梯;电梯轿厢意外移动;检测
